Presidential Scholarship

The Presidential Scholarship is awarded to a select group of highly accomplished high school seniors who demonstrate superior academic achievement, leadership qualities and community involvement.

This scholarship includes full tuition and a room and board stipend over four years at Drake University (estimated value $185,000). Recipients also receive access to personal laptops, iPads and other technology resources through the Drake Technology Advantage Program.

Students with exceptional academic ability are encouraged to apply for the Presidential Scholarship by completing the application for admission to Drake University on or before January 15.

Duration of the Award

The Presidential Scholarship is renewable for up to eight consecutive semesters, provided that the recipient remains a full-time student (12 or more hours per semester) and maintains a cumulative GPA of at least 3.5.

Students who receive the scholarship must remain enrolled at Drake as a full-time student for the entire academic year (fall, spring and winter terms) each year in order to maintain eligibility. This includes study abroad programs that are operated by Drake University; however, students who take leave from Drake University may not receive the Presidential Scholarship while they are away from campus. Students who take leaves of absence during their freshman year may apply for reconsideration once readmitted, but there is no guarantee of renewal if you are absent longer than one semester (excluding summer). After any absence, students must meet all criteria listed above in order to be eligible for the award upon return.

The Presidential Scholarship covers eight consecutive semesters of undergraduate enrollment at Drake University. Students who leave Drake for any period of time lose their scholarship and must reapply for admission. They are not guaranteed readmission to Drake or readmission on another scholarship beyond the standard merit scholarships offered to all admitted freshmen. Students are strongly advised not to take a semester off from Drake University during their four years of study. Withdrawing from all classes during any semester counts as a leave of absence, and students would be required to reapply for admission. Requests for exceptions may be made in writing to the Associate Provost for Enrollment Management prior to taking time off from Drake.
